Oracle® Database Lite to Support Symbian OS Print E-mail
Written by Oracle   
Tuesday, 27 September 2005
To enable the secure transmission of critical business data to mobile workers, Oracle has announced that Oracle(R) Database Lite 10g Release 2 will support Symbian OS(TM), the global open industry standard operating system installed on more than 39 million data-enabled mobile phones.

Oracle and Symbian Partner to Provide Mobile Users with Access to Critical Business Applications

Oracle's support for Symbian OS will deliver the many benefits of Oracle's grid technology, including continuous data and application availability, from the enterprise to mobile workers. Oracle is a Symbian Platinum Partner and will distribute its mobile database alongside Symbian OS, enabling interoperability of data-enabled mobile phones with mobile networks, applications and services. Together, the companies will be able to extend enterprise applications, such as customer relationship management and sales force automation to the growing number of Symbian OS-based smartphones worldwide.

"Symbian's partnership with Oracle is delivering on the promise of workforce mobile enablement -- improving business user productivity both in, and away, from the office," said Jerry Panagrossi, vice president of U.S. operations, Symbian. "The combination of Oracle's market leading mobile database technology with Symbian's industry leading mobile handset operating system, Symbian OS, assures that enterprise mobile workers will have access to all of their mission-critical data when they need it."

Oracle Database Lite 10g Release 2 for Symbian OS will enable enterprise and consumer applications to have data access with high performance and complex data manipulations. Together, Oracle and Symbian are working with leading mobile network operators and phone manufacturers, including NTT DoCoMo, Motorola and Nokia to deliver an integrated solution. Oracle Database Lite 10g Release 2 is already available on NTT's DoCoMo Business FOMA(R) M1000 environment, Motorola's A1000 and phones based on both of Nokia's Developer platforms, Series 60 and Series 80 such as Nokia's 9300 and 6630. Oracle is also working with independent software vendors (ISVs) such as NID-IS, Softbrain, and TENIK to deliver applications and tools required by businesses to support their mobile initiatives.

"NTT DoCoMo welcomes Oracle's commitment to the mobile technology and industry," said Kiyoshi Tokuhiro, Managing Director, Ubiquitous Services Department, Products & Services Division, NTT DoCoMo, Inc. "By utilizing DoCoMo's Business FOMA environment, Oracle takes full advantage of development and validation to adopt Oracle Database Lite 10g for Symbian OS, enabling people to access all of their critical data whenever they need it. We believe we are in a position to roll-out development of new, value add services that will positively impact our enterprise customers and their businesses."

Oracle Database Lite 10g Release 2, which became generally available in July 2005, boasts significant enhancements that make it easier to create mobile schemas, deliver high availability options and leverage the Microsoft .NET development platform. Relying on the Oracle Grid Computing infrastructure, the mobile database provides customers with a secure and reliable technology architecture that enables increased performance and incremental scalability to support thousands of concurrent users.

"Handset vendors and carriers are always looking for new services to maintain and increase revenue generating opportunities," said Andrew Mendelsohn, senior vice president of Database Server Technologies, Oracle. "Oracle Database Lite provides the perfect high performance, reliable and secure database to manage handset data to support these new services."

Mobile technologies are no longer simply the domain of sales force and field service workers, increasingly adopted by industries such as defense, national security, health care and public safety. With organizations entrusting their critical data to mobile technology, centralized management, security and application functionality have become essential as applications are rolled out to tens of thousands of mobile users.

About Oracle Database Lite 10g

Oracle Database Lite 10g is the first database to extend the power of grid computing to the mobile workforce. Oracle Database Lite 10g is a complete and integrated solution for developing and deploying vital database applications for mobile and embedded environments and delivers features common in mission- critical systems to mobile and embedded devices. Enabling persistent access to critical information and applications without requiring continuous connectivity to back-end enterprise systems, Oracle Database Lite 10g enables users to increase efficiency, productivity and responsiveness of mobile workforces, reduces costs, and improves customer satisfaction.
